WebIf Administrative errors were made in Box 2 or in Box 6 (typo, etc), a W2-c needs to be filed. When to Submit Form W-2c. Form W-2c should be submitted immediately after discovering the mistake on Form W-2. When sending Form W-2c to the Social Security Administration, Form W-3c, which is the proper transmittal form, must also be filed with it.

WebIf you received a Form W-2 that wasn't reported on your original return, you should amend on IRS Form 1040X. Assuming you e-filed your (incorrect) return and you have confirmed it was accepted by IRS, you should wait until this original return completes processing and you receive your refund.

Web21 feb. 2024 · If you have already filed your tax return, you may need to file an amended return (but see bel0w).
